Lobster Fritters from Cooks.com
Ingredients
- 1 cup flour
- 1 tsp. salt
- 1 tsp. baking powder
- 2 eggs
- 1/4 cup milk
- 1 tbsp. melted vegetable shortening
- 1/2 tsp. cayenne pepper
- 1 lb. lobster from tails, cut in chunks
Instructions
1. Sift dry ingredients together.
2. Add beaten eggs, milk, and shortening. Stir together and add the lobster meat.
3. Drop by tablespoon in deep fat (365 degrees) for 4-5 minutes. (Or on the stove with canola oil.)
4. Serve with green salad and a cold beer.
